Lebanese President Slams Continued Israeli Aggression

President Michel Aoun meets with US Central Command head Gen. Joseph Votel at Baabda Palace. Dalati and Nohra photo

President Michel Aoun has reiterated that “Lebanon will never be an aggressive country, but we refuse any aggression on our land.”

Aoun made his statement on Friday during talks with United States Central Command head Gen. Joseph Votel, who visited Baabda Palace.

Discussions focused on military cooperation with Lebanon as well as regional security developments and US military assistance to the country.

The meeting was attended by both a Lebanese and American delegation that included US Ambassador to Lebanon Elizabeth Richard.

They also discussed ongoing Israeli violations of Lebanon’s air, maritime and land borders, condemned by Aoun.

The president said a tripartite meeting between Israel and Lebanon, mediated by the United Nations peacekeeping mission, is expected to be held next month to “end Israeli violations of Lebanon’s international border.”

Votel reiterated his country’s support to the Lebanese army and security forces, and stressed the consolidation of cooperation between the two sides.
